Hawked Server Closure to Discontinue All Xbox Achievements

Why It Matters

The shutdown eliminates a rare achievement grind and signals My Games’ strategic shift toward newer projects, affecting both players and the Xbox achievement ecosystem.

Key Takeaways

  • •Hawked servers shut down September 7, 2026
  • •All 29 Xbox achievements discontinued
  • •Game becomes unplayable after server closure
  • •Renegade Pass extended to September 8 with free pack

Pulse Analysis

Server shutdowns have become a familiar chapter in the lifecycle of free‑to‑play shooters, especially on console platforms where online connectivity is mandatory. Xbox’s achievement system, a long‑standing driver of player engagement, often sees titles retire their trophy trees when support ends. Hawked’s impending closure illustrates how developers balance community expectations against the cost of maintaining legacy infrastructure, a decision that reverberates through the broader gaming ecosystem.

For Hawked fans, the timeline is clear: servers go dark on September 7, 2026, and the title will be delisted on March 11. This leaves a narrow window for achievement hunters to chase the 29 Xbox trophies, a pursuit already proven difficult—only 42 of roughly 12,000 players have completed the full set, requiring 80‑100 hours of play. My Games mitigates the blow by extending the Renegade Pass to September 8, offering free access to the Realities Pack and unlocking all in‑game shop content, giving remaining players a final chance to experience the game before it disappears.

The broader implication is a strategic reallocation of resources by My Games, which recently announced the shutdown of another free‑to‑play shooter, Warface: Clutch. Such moves suggest a pivot toward newer titles or platforms that promise higher returns. For the industry, this underscores the importance of sustainable live‑service models and the need for players to prioritize time‑sensitive content. Gamers aiming to preserve their achievement portfolios should act swiftly, while developers must communicate clear timelines to maintain trust and minimize backlash.
